Connecting to a Faraway Station Using WIRES-X

Connecting in digital mode

Caution
Before using WIRES-X, press % to set the communication mode of band A (shown on the top part
of the screen) to any mode other than [FM]. For details, refer to "Selecting Communication Mode" in
the basic operating manual.

Connecting to a local node

1
Rotate O to set band A to the frequency of the
desired local node
Tip
You can directly enter the frequency using the numerical
keypad. After entering, press H.
2
Press and hold % for 1 second or more
[ X ] will flash on the left side of the frequency
indication.
When a local node is found, [ X ] will be lit solid, and
the node name and city name will appear on the
bottom part of the screen.
Tip
Depending on the connection status, the screen will
show one of four display patterns.
(1)
Connected to the local node, but unable to connect
to Internet nodes or rooms (never before established
connection to Internet nodes or rooms)
(2)
Connected to the local node, but unable to connect
to Internet nodes or rooms (previously succeeded in
establishing connection to Internet nodes or rooms)
